I love your story . In 2005 I was 40 years old and I got diagnosed with GBS. They think mine started from a back injury. Within 4 days from my first symptoms I was in the ICU on life support. Before being admitted to the hospital I went to the emergency room 3 times telling them something was wrong. They thought I was seeking pain pills. I begged them not to send me home . I knew something was seriously wrong. My last ER visit I was sent home barely able to stand on my legs. I went home that afternoon and laid on my sofa and told my husband I was going to die that day. He didn't know what to do. Every time he took me to the hospital they would send me home. I told him to please call my mom as I wanted to see her before I died. She could not believe my condition when she got to my home. At first she was angry with my husband but what do you do when doctors keep sending you home. She called an ambulance and by the time they arrived I was like a limp rag doll. There is no love like a mother's love. When we arrived she said we are not leaving until you tell me what is wrong with my child. Luckily this ER visit there was a neurologist there that did a spinal tap and found the problem. By that night I was on life support. I was totally paralyzed, I even lost my sight for a few days due to my brain swelling on my optic nerve. My family called in a priest as I was not expected to make it through the night. God is good. 20 years later I am still here. I am not 100 % . My left foot is partially paralyzed and my leg strength is very weak. I have to push myself up when I get up from a seated position and I have to use a cane when I walk. It was a huge battle to recover. Thank you for your story and thank you for letting me tell mine. Gog bless

God bless you. I had GBS when I was a year old . My dad was in the Army and transferred to Fort Campbell Kentucky army base, we left behind hIm driving from California to Kentucky , my mom said I was fine at first, then I got sick very high temp. 104 and I was screaming in pain..I broke out in a rash. I wouldn't eat. She took me to the Army hospital they did 5 spinal taps was told that I have GBS now this was 60 years ago when GBS was so new most Doctors even knew about it. But I got a great pediatric neurologist I had a trike and was completely paralyzed neck down; But with in a year I stated to move my finger. By the next 6 months I was was learning to walk my mom said I was just beginning to walk when I got sick. I was in the hospital for 1 1/2 yrs. By the good Lord I got better. I'm in the medical journals of being one of the first baby to get GBS. I had to wear special shoes and braces when I went to school, by the time I went to JHS I didn't need any more braces or specially shoes. All this was told to me by my parents and family. I went to USC and graduated with a nursing degree BSN I work for 33 yrs and I did my thesis on GBS. I believe that our good Lord heals in a special way, God bless you always XOXO

Almost 2 months ago (on a Thursday) my mom came in from work complaining of numbness in her hands and face. By noon on Saturday she was being intubated because her breathing muscles were no longer functioning. She was completely paralyzed from the neck down. When admitted into ICU and placed on life support that day, the only parts of her body she could move were her eyeballs and her tongue. Today ends the 7th week since our world was turned upside down by GBS. 21 days since I heard my momma say "I love you". 504 hours since she kissed the 5 grandkids that she has custody of goodnight. 30,240 minutes since she looked me in the eye and begged for air. 1,814,400 seconds since fear took it's permanent place on her face and in our hearts. She completed one round of IVIG treatment 6 weeks ago. She can now move her feet, wiggle her hips and turn her head to the right side. She had a tracheostomy tube placed and can communicate by mouthing words. A second round of IVIG will be given this coming week along with her swallow test and conversion from NG tube (in her nose) to a gastrostomy tube (in her stomach).
